What companies run services between Botany, NSW, Australia and Ingleburn, NSW, Australia?

There is no direct connection from Botany to Ingleburn. However, you can take the line 307 bus to Mascot Station, Coward St, Stand A, walk to Mascot Station, then take the train to Ingleburn Station. Alternatively, you can drive from Botany to Ingleburn in around 33 min.
